    Dear Denise. Geylang Lor 29 Hokkien Mee is located in 396 East Coast “food ‘r us” hawker centre. I have been in Singapore the last 24 years and I cannot think of any better hokkien mee stall. The prawns are very fresh and large the mee is the right mix of mee (the thin and the large) and they are blended with a super gravy made of the heads of the prawns (cholesterol punch) but who cares. The lard is chanky and crispy. And last but not least Alex is cooking on charcoal, which gives an estraordinary smooky flavor to the mee. What can I say I can die for it.
